• The Kivach waterfall cascades over a section of 170 meters. The total height of the fall is 10.7 meters, and the main ledge is 8 meters.

  • It is situated on the Suna River in the Kondopoga District, Republic of Karelia and gives its name to the Kivach Natural Reserve, founded in 1931.
